International Medical Graduates (IMGs)
For those who study abroad, the process involves an additional layer of verification. The Educational Commission for Foreign Medical Graduates (ECFMG) acts as the gatekeeper, guaranteeing that the global medical school meets worldwide standards. The costs connected with ECFMG certification become part of the legal expense of getting a license for foreign-trained physicians.

Residency and Postgraduate Training
While a medical trainee finishes with a degree, they are not yet lawfully qualified for [Ärztliche approbation problemlos kaufen](https://medicallicenseonsale24665.blogs-service.com/72317574/the-most-convincing-evidence-that-you-need-buy-medical-license-safely) a full, unlimited medical license. They need to finish a period of monitored practice referred to as residency. This stage usually lasts three to 7 years, depending upon the specialty.

Throughout residency, the "expense" is not simply financial; it is a financial investment of time. However, there are administrative costs included in the legal side of residency, such as getting a "Training License" or "Limited Permit" which enables locals to practice within the boundaries of their health center programs.

Lawfully "buying" a license is not a one-time transaction. Medical licenses need to be restored periodically (generally every 2 years). This renewal process guarantees that the doctor stays healthy to practice.
Continuing Medical Education (CME)
To keep a license active, medical professionals should purchase continuous education. The majority of states need 20 to 50 hours of CME annually. These courses can cost anywhere from ₤ 500 to ₤ 5,000 yearly.
Renewal Fees
Boards charge renewal fees to maintain the medical professional's status in their computer registry. These fees usually v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 1,000 per cycle.

3. Are licensing costs refundable if my application is rejected?
Typically, no. Licensing fees are "processing costs." If a board rejects an application due to a rap sheet or absence of certifications, they normally retain the cost.
4. Can I practice in any state once I have one license?
A medical license is typically state-specific. However, programs like the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C) enable physicians to streamline the process of "buying" additional licenses in taking part states.
5. What are the "surprise costs" of a medical license?
Surprise costs include professional liability insurance coverage (malpractice insurance coverage), background check costs, fingerprinting services, and the expense of travel to board interviews if required.
